[S1] ## 🧠 핵심 개념 (Core concepts) - **Memory management** — the process of controlling how much memory a program uses, via three operations: allocation, reallocation, and deallocation ("freeing"). [S1] - **Automatic sizing for basic variables** — C automatically reserves the correct byte size for `int`/`float`/`double`/`char` variables; `sizeof` reveals these sizes (4/4/8/1 bytes respectively). [S1] - **Manual responsibility** — unlike some languages, C requires the PROGRAMMER to manage memory explicitly, which is more error-prone but enables finer performance control. [S1] - **Pointers as the memory-management tool** — since dynamic memory is only reachable via pointers, memory management is inherently pointer-based work.
